Somatic Nervous System
The somatic nervous system is part of the peripheral nervous system responsible for controlling voluntary movements of the body and transmitting sensory information to the central nervous system.
Central Nervous System
The part of the nervous system consisting of the brain and spinal cord, responsible for processing and sending out information throughout the body.
Sensory Neurons
Nerve cells that are responsible for converting external stimuli from the environment into internal electrical impulses.
Stem Cells
Undifferentiated cells with the potential to develop into many different cell types that can contribute to repairing and replenishing tissues.
